
- •Архитектура компьютера
- •Поколения компьютеров – история развития вычислительной техники
- •Второе поколение. Компьютеры на транзисторах (1955-1965)
- •Третье поколение. Компьютеры на интегральных схемах (1965-1980)
- •Четвертое поколение. Компьютеры на больших (и сверхбольших) интегральных схемах (1980-…)
- •Типы компьютеров.
- •Персональные компьютеры (пк)
- •Игровые компьютеры
- •Карманные компьютеры (кпк, Планшеты)
- •Микроконтроллеры
- •Серверы
- •Мейнфреймы
- •Суперкомпьютеры
- •Рабочие станции
- •История персональных компьютеров
- •Принципы фон Неймана (Архитектура фон Неймана)
- •Принципы фон Неймана
- •Как работает машина фон Неймана
- •Основные принципы работы компьютера
- •Устройство процессора и его назначение
- •Работа процессора
- •Vliw-процессоры
- •Оперативная память компьютера (озу, ram)
- •Назначение озу
- •Особенности работы озу
- •Логическое устройство оперативной памяти
- •Типы оперативной памяти
- •Разделы жесткого диска
- •Контроллеры и шина
- •Магнитные диски
Логическое устройство оперативной памяти
Оперативная память состоит их ячеек, каждая из которых имеет свой собственный адрес. Все ячейки содержат одинаковое число бит. Соседние ячейки имеют последовательные адреса. Адреса памяти также как и данные выражаются в двоичных числах.
Обычно одна ячейка содержит 1 байт информации (8 бит, то же самое, что 8 разрядов) и является минимальной единицей информации, к которой возможно обращение. Однако многие команды работают с так называемыми словами. Слово представляет собой область памяти, состоящую из 4 или 8 байт (возможны другие варианты).
Типы оперативной памяти
Принято выделять два вида оперативной памяти: статическую (SRAM) и динамическую (DRAM). SRAM используется в качестве кэш-памяти процессора, а DRAM - непосредственно в роли оперативной памяти компьютера.
SRAM состоит из триггеров. Триггеры могут находиться лишь в двух состояниях: «включен» или «выключен» (хранение бита). Триггер не хранит заряд, поэтому переключение между состояниями происходит очень быстро. Однако триггеры требуют более сложную технологию производства. Это неминуемо отражается на цене устройства. Во-вторых, триггер, состоящий из группы транзисторов и связей между ними, занимает много места (на микроуровне), в результате SRAM получается достаточно большим устройством.
В DRAM нет триггеров, а бит сохраняется за счет использования одного транзистора и одного конденсатора. Получается дешевле и компактней. Однако конденсаторы хранят заряд, а процесс зарядки-разрядки более длительный, чем переключение триггера. Как следствие, DRAM работает медленнее. Второй минус – это самопроизвольная разрядка конденсаторов. Для поддержания заряда его регенерируют через определенные промежутки времени, на что тратится дополнительное время.
Разделы жесткого диска
Обычно жесткий диск делят на несколько разделов. Это бывает удобно для хранения файлов и является необходимым условием при установке нескольких операционных систем на один физический жесткий диск компьютера.
Итак, раздел диска – это часть жесткого диска, используемая под определенные задачи: файловую систему того или иного типа, область подкачки и т.п. Изменение содержимого и файловой системы одного раздела никак не сказывается на других.
В Linux разделы диска принято именовать так: hda1, hda2, hda3 и т.д. - для первого (или единственного) физического жесткого диска компьютера.
Если на компьютере стоит несколько жестких дисков, то разделы второго будут именоваться так: hdb1, hdb2, hdb3 и т.д. Третьего - hdс1, hdс2, hdс3 и т.д.
Основных разделов (primary partition) на каждом жестком диске может быть всего четыре. Соответственно от hd_1 до hd_4. (Знак подчеркивания здесь употребляется для обозначения буквы того или иного физического жеского диска).
Однако часто бывает так, что четырех разделов диска становится недостаточно. Поэтому один из основных разделов диска объявляется расширенным (extended partition) и разбивается на подразделы, начиная с hd_5 и далее.
Пример:
В данном примере на компьютере установлен один жесткий диск, имеющий четыре основных раздела (хотя их может быть и меньше) – hda1, hda2, hda3, hda4. Последний является расширенным и разбит на пять частей (hda5, hda6, hda7, hda8, hda9), суммарный размер которых равен около 60 гигабайт.
На рисунке на графическом изображении жесткого диска расширенный раздел обведен голубой рамкой.
Второй столбец таблицы – Filesystem – отражает тип файловой системы раздела. Для разделов операционных систем семейства Windows используется файловая система NTFS или Fat32. Для разделов Linux – ext3, ext2 или другие.
Раздел hda5, в данном случае, отведен на раздел подкачки (linux-swap) для систем Linux.